In this role, you have the opportunity to make life better

You will contribute with your expertise in Operational Quality towards ensuring compliance of Philips commercial organization in Korea. You will work extensively with the district leadership team to deploy Quality Management System, oversee local Post Market Surveillance and maintain compliance to Philips Policies and applicable local regulations. You will also have the opportunity to work in a highly matrix organization across functions.

You are responsible for

  • Philips Korea¡¯s QMS Management compliance and tracking of Quality related KPIs in accordance with ISO 13485, Korea Medical Device Regulations and Philips policies.
  • Deploying global quality objectives with necessary local additions (or adjustments) to drive sustained improvements to QMS.
  • Be part of district Leadership Team, manage team budget, and set-up strategic plans in alignment with function & business goals.
  • Drive adherence to compliance and process improvement, through effective use of CAPA process.
  • Supporting Quality & as well Regulatory Capabilities including Supplier Quality/ PQMS.
  • Represent Philips at local authorities e.g. MFDS
  • Ensuring timely submission of Medical Device and Safety Vigilance Reports within the defined time to Regulatory Agencies/ Competent Authority (CA). 
  • Tracks status of reported incidents with Competent Authority ensuring all cases are closed by CA following adequate submission of objective evidence.
  • Coordinates extensively with various manufacturing sites on product quality/ customer complaints or recall actions.
  • Oversees recall & correction management through effective Customer & CA Communication, tracking of Field Actions, good record tracing and closure of actions with local authority.
  • Manages customer feedback by ensuring right owners respond/ resolve in timely manner.
  • Works collaboratively with Customer Service and SCM organizations.
  • Oversees personnel training for QMS processes.
  • Lead the internal & External audit program for the district.
  • Lead the management review for the district.
  • Lead country quality team through coaching, developing and supervising for success.

We are looking for someone with the following skills, knowledge and experience

  • Bachelor¡¯s/ Master¡¯s Degree in Quality Management/Engineering/Science/Technical discipline.
  • More than 10 years of Quality Management and/or Regulatory Affairs experience in the medical devices industry.
  • Expertise in driving operational quality related improvement strategies to address compliance, product quality issues – both from oversight, leading and facilitating others.
  • Competent in delivering trainings in the various Operational Quality & lean tools to drive improvements in a quality arena.
  • Experienced in working in an Operational Quality environment, including in quality management systems is required. Knowledge of ISO 13485 is required.
  • Demonstrated ability to work with senior/executive leaders and be able to engage/influence cross functional leadership teams.
  • Good experience working with MFDS, local authorities, and Notified Body audits and inspections with favorable outcomes.
  • Proven leadership ability to carry out difficult decisions in a logical, rational manner and work with senior leadership management team member and to engage and influence team members in a matrixed environment.
